
Believers Church Medical College Hospital Thiruvalla Kerala was founded in 2016, is also famous as BCMCH Thiruvalla, situated at Thiruvalla. BCMCH Thiruvalla is one of the leading Medical Colleges in Kerala. Believers Church Medical College and hospital are run by the approval of the NMC under the Union Ministry of Health and Family Welfare, Government of India.

Believers Church Medical College Hospital Thiruvalla
Believers Church Medical College Hospital Thiruvalla is attached to a 500-bed, multi-speciality hospital. It is situated on a campus of about 25 acres (10 ha) connected by rail and road.

MBBS Syllabus
Here in this selection, we will let you know about BCMCH Thiruvalla MBBS Syllabus. Let’s have a look.
Phase | Semester | Subjects Covered |
Pre-clinical | 1-2: Two Semesters | Anatomy, Biochemistry, Physiology |
Para-clinical | 3-4-5: Three Semesters | Community Medicine; Forensic Medicine, Pathology, Pharmacology, Microbiology, Clinical postings inwards, OPDs to begin here; |
Clinical | 6-7-8-9: Four Semesters | Community Medicine, Medicine and allied subjects (Psychiatry, Dermatology); Obst. Gynae.; Pediatrics; Surgery and allied subjects (Anesthesiology, E.N.T., Ophthalmology, Orthopaedics); Clinical postings; |
MBBS Internship
Subjects | Compulsory time duration for Internship |
Community Medicine | Two months |
Medicine including 15 days of Psychiatry | Two months |
Surgery including 15 days Anaesthesia | Two months |
Obstt./Gynae. including Family Welfare Planning | Two months |
Paediatrics | One month |
Orthopaedics including PMR | One month |
E.N.T | 15 days |
Ophthalmology | 15 days |
Casualty | 15 days |
Elective posting | 15 days |
Total | 12 months |

Kerala NEET Counselling Process
Step 1- Log in Process: Candidates must log on to the ‘candidate portal’ to participate in the counselling process.
Step 2- Option registration page: In the next step, applicants will have to create a password and click on the ‘open registration’ button available on the login page.
Step 3- Choice filling and locking: The online choice filling of Kerala NEET counselling will look on the screen. There will be a list of colleges available with college, college code, place, courses, and the district name.
Step 4- Kerala NEET seat allotment process: After the choice and locking section, the authority will start Kerala MBBS/BDS seat allotment 2021.
Step 5- Kerala NEET counselling result: After the seat allotment process is over, CEE, Kerala, releases Kerala NEET 2021 counselling results online.
Counselling Procedure
Before we speak about the counselling procedure for Kerala NEET 2021, Let us first look at the Type of NEET Counselling 2021 for state and AIQ quota.
Type of NEET Counselling | Counselling Body |
NEET Counselling for 15% AIQ Seats (except in Jammu & Kashmir) in Government medical and dental colleges | DGHS, on behalf of MCC |
NEET Counselling for 85% State Quota seats in DU colleges (MAMC, LHMC, UCMS) | DGHS, on behalf of MCC |
NEET Counselling for all the seats in Central and Deemed Universities, including BDS at Jamia Millia Islamia, New Delhi | DGHS, on behalf of MCC |
NEET Counselling for IP Quota seats in ESIC Colleges | DGHS, on behalf of MCC |
NEET Counselling for Armed Forces Medical College (AFMC) | DGHS, on behalf of MCC and AFMC Pune |
NEET Counselling for 85% State Quota seats (all the seats in case of Jammu & Kashmir) and state private colleges | Respective State Counselling Authorities |
